Chassis, Suspension, Brakes & Wheels

FrametypeTubular steel
FrontbrakesSingle disc
Frontbrakesdiameter190 mm (7.5 inches)
FrontsuspensionHydraulic fork with ø32 mm shaft
Fronttyre130/60-13
Frontwheeltravel95 mm (3.7 inches)
RearbrakesSingle disc
Rearbrakesdiameter190 mm (7.5 inches)
RearsuspensionMonoshock with adjustable spring preload
Reartyre130/60-13
Rearwheeltravel89 mm (3.5 inches)

Engine & Transmission

Borexstroke40.0 x 39.2 mm (1.6 x 1.5 inches)
ClutchDry automatic centrifugal type
Compression12.0:1
CoolingsystemLiquid
Displacement49.00 ccm (2.99 cubic inches)
EnginedetailsSingle cylinder, two-stroke
FuelsystemCarburettor. Dell´Orto PHVA 12
GearboxAutomatic
LubricationsystemWith mechanical pump - mix gasoline-oil 1,5% (with synthetic oil)
TransmissiontypefinaldriveBelt

Physical Measures & Capacities

Dryweight88.0 kg (194.0 pounds)
Fuelcapacity7.50 litres (1.98 gallons)
Groundclearance215 mm (8.5 inches)
Overallheight1,150 mm (45.3 inches)
Overalllength1,740 mm (68.5 inches)
Overallwidth830 mm (32.7 inches)
Reservefuelcapacity1.30 litres (0.34 gallons)

About Beta Ark LC Tribe 2008

Introducing the 2008 Beta Ark LC Tribe, a remarkable scooter that melds Italian flair with practical functionality, offering a thrilling ride for both urban commuters and weekend adventurers. With a lightweight design and a robust build, the Ark LC Tribe stands out in the crowded scooter market, appealing to riders who prioritize agility and ease of maneuverability. Beta, renowned for its innovation in two-wheeled vehicles, has crafted this model to deliver not only style but also a performance-oriented ride that is perfect for navigating city streets or cruising along scenic routes.

At the heart of the Ark LC Tribe lies its spirited 49cc single-cylinder, two-stroke engine, designed to offer an exhilarating experience with every twist of the throttle. With a compression ratio of 12.0:1 and a bore and stroke of 40.0 x 39.2 mm, this engine strikes a fine balance between power and efficiency. The liquid cooling system ensures that the engine operates optimally, even during spirited rides. The automatic gearbox, paired with a dry automatic centrifugal clutch, allows for seamless gear shifts without the need for manual intervention, making it incredibly user-friendly. Riders can expect a smooth, responsive ride that thrives in urban environments, with enough punch to tackle those steep inclines effortlessly.

The Beta Ark LC Tribe is not just about engine performance; it also boasts a range of features designed to enhance the riding experience. The tubular steel frame provides durability and strength, while the hydraulic front fork and monoshock rear suspension with adjustable spring preload ensure a comfortable ride over various terrains. The front and rear disc brakes, both measuring 190 mm in diameter, deliver reliable stopping power, instilling confidence in riders as they navigate through bustling traffic. With a fuel capacity of 7.50 liters, this scooter promises extended rides without the need for frequent refueling, making it a practical choice for everyday use.
